我使用的是nginx,客运和rvm 1.19
一切都很顺利,但是当我在rails项目的根部创建.rvmrc时,如下所示:
rvm使用1.9.3@rails3213 3213
然后启动nginx,这是它第一次工作,但是一段时间后,当我在浏览器中加载我的页面时,服务器会给我PAGE NOT FOUND,当我cd到我的项目时,它会给我这样的警告:
您正在使用'. rvmrc ',它需要信任,速度较慢,并且与其他ruby管理器不兼容,您可以使用'rvm rvmrc到.ruby-version‘切换到'.ruby-version’,或者使用'rvm rvmrc警告忽略/home/ubuntu/projects/test/.rvmrc‘忽略此警告,'.rvmrc’将继续是RVM 1和RVM 2中的默认项目文件,从而忽略所有运行‘rvmrc警告’的文件忽略all.rvmrcs的警告。
/home/ubuntu/.rvm/gems/ruby-1.9.3-p392与gemset rails3213的结合
有人能帮忙吗?
发布于 2013-03-30 05:29:48
你已经信任你的档案了吗?
rvm rvmrc trust /home/ubuntu/projects/test顺便问一下,你的应用程序运行得怎么样了?我的意思是,您有nginx,您使用什么来运行rails,您是如何从nginx到rails的代理的?
发布于 2013-04-25 06:25:27
(...)您可以使用“rvm rvmrc”切换到“..ruby version”。 或使用“rvmrc警告忽略/(.)/.rvmrc”(.)忽略此警告。
我会试试的。
另外,看一看Use rvmrc or ruby-version file to set a project gemset with RVM?
https://stackoverflow.com/questions/15714785
复制相似问题